Обзор Joplin. Сервис заметок и список дел с открытым кодом

Константин Докучаев
Константин Докучаев
Обзор Joplin. Сервис заметок и список дел с открытым кодом
Capital

Сегодня я снова подниму тему сервисов для заметок. В этой статье я решил взглянуть на бесплатный сервис с открытым исходным кодом и синхронизацией — Joplin. Посмотрим, насколько он соответствует своему названию, или тут, наоборот, всё круто.

Joplin — сервис для хранения заметок и управления делами с синхронизацией между устройствами. Он доступен на Windows, macOS, Linux, Android и iOS.

У сервиса также есть свой веб-клиппер для Google Chrome и Firefox и возможность работы через терминал. Есть возможность импорта данных из сторонних сервисов, например с Evernote.

Для обзора я взял не требующую установки Windows-версию, Android-приложение и клиппер для Chrome.

Преимущества по сравнению с аналогами

Я хочу сразу начать с блока преимуществ. Они не бросаются в глаза при первом использовании Joplin, но многие из них станут решающим выбором в пользу этого сервиса.

Работа с терминалом поддерживается не только на Linux и macOS, как мы привыкли, но и на Windows. Как всё настроить, можно узнать из специального раздела документации.

Синхронизация поддерживает сторонние сервисы. Кроме привычных Dropbox и OneDrive, есть поддержка WebDav и Nextcloud. Если вы знаете, зачем нужны последние два слова, значит, вам точно нужен Joplin.

Поддержка CSS-вёрстки в заметках. По умолчанию для заметок используется Markdown, но его отображение можно настроить с помощью собственных CSS-стилей. Для этого нужно положить файл с пользовательскими стилями в папку программы. Интересно, что таким образом можно настроить не только внешний вид заметок, но и всего UI приложения.

Схожим образом происходит работа с шаблонами заметок. С помощью файла настроек в папке шаблонов приложения и «магии» Markdown можно создавать свои шаблоны.

Отличий от конкурентов у Joplin ещё много, но о них я расскажу ниже. Сейчас я хотел выделить самые важные моменты, которые я не видел у конкурентов.

Внешний вид

При первом запуске Joplin ничем не отличается от привычных инструментов для хранения заметок. Интерфейс привычно разделён на: список блокнотов, заметки и саму заметку с редактором.

Внешний вид можно настроить под себя из соответствующего меню. Можно отключить лишние панели, настроить сортировку, зум, выбрать вкладку по умолчанию и многое другое.

Редактор заметок

Как я писал выше, в редакторе по умолчанию используется Markdown. При наборе текста в редакторе справа отображается рендер заметки. Если вы не знаете, как набирать теги разметки от руки, всю вёрстку можно настроить с помощью панели инструментов вверху.

Сам редактор обладает широкими возможностями по форматированию и поддержке сторонних файлов. Можно легко добавлять изображения, файлы, эмодзи, дату и время, нумерацию. Кроме этого, работать с заметками можно в любом внешнем редакторе.

Можно пойти ещё дальше и переключиться на экспериментальный визуальный редактор, в котором возможностей чуть больше. Но не так чтобы уж совсем. Но в нём проще работать с таблицами или кодом.

Можно пойти и ещё дальше. В настройках Joplin можно включить различные Markdowns-плагины, и начать работать, например, с Fountain синтаксисом.

К заметкам можно добавлять теги. А вся история изменения хранится в приложении, и можно быстро откатиться к старой версии.

Работа со списком дел по факту здесь для красного словца. То есть при нажатии на «New to-do» открывается обычный редактор заметки, в котором вы просто создаёте список дел с чек-боксами. Полноценный планировщик дел не предусмотрен. Хотя есть возможность установки напоминаний.

Заметки хранятся в многоуровневых блокнотах.

Навигация по заметкам

Для поиска заметок в Joplin предусмотрено несколько вариантов: панель с блокнотами и тегами, список заметок и поиск.

Разработчики особенно выделяют возможности поиска. Через специальную панель или по нажатию Ctrl+G/ Cmd+G можно произвести поиск по любой части содержимого заметки, чтобы быстро найти нужную информацию.

Поиск поддерживает различные операторы.

Мобильная версия

Версия для Android и iOS может послужить полноценной альтернативой десктопу. Хотя работать с Markdown на телефоне — то ещё удовольствие.

Также без включения синхронизации здесь уже не обойтись.

Веб-клиппер

Первый запуск клиппера происходит немного странно. В настройках Joplin нужно активировать службу веб-клиппера, только потом установить расширение для браузера.

При нажатии на иконку расширения вы можете выбрать один из типов захвата страницы: упрощённая версия, полная версия, HTML-версия, часть страницы, сделать скриншот, сохранить ссылку.

Можно выбрать папку для хранения и сразу задать теги.

Клипы сохраняются в Markdown-формате, но проблем с сайтами я не заметил. У меня всё сохранилось идеально.

Импорт данных

Joplin «из коробки» поддерживает импорт ENEX-файлов Evernote. При импорте вы сохраните сами заметки, теги, вложения, метаинформацию. Сами заметки будут преобразованы в Markdown-файлы.

Вы потеряете информацию OCR, которую Evernote хранит для всех изображений в ваших заметках. Также собьётся часть форматирования.

ENEX-файлы, кроме Evernote, умеют создавать и другие сервисы. К примеру: Standard Notes, Tomboy Notes, OneNote, NixNote.

Также в приложение можно импортировать любые Markdown-файлы.

Экспорт данных

Joplin при экспорте создаёт файл формата JEX, который по факту является обычным tar-архивом. В нём хранится вся информация из заметки.

Прочие возможности

Приложение поддерживает end-to-end шифрование. Почитать о нём подробно можно на сайте разработчиков. Шифрование по умолчанию выключено, и его нужно включать самостоятельно. При этом создаётся ключ шифрования, основанный на пароле. С его помощью можно будет получить доступ к заметкам на остальных устройствах.

Синхронизация в Joplin работает с помощью сторонних сервисов (OneDrive, Dropbox, WebDaw, Nextcloud, AWS S3) или системных возможностей.

Приложение переведено на более чем 20 языков. Есть русский, а вот украинского или белорусского — нет.


Как ни странно, Joplin показал себя значительно лучше других подобных сервисов, даже платных. Я привык работать с Markdown, а Dropbox у меня и так используется для синхронизации информации.

При работе я не заметил каких-то явных ошибок или проблем. Интерфейс удобный и понятный.

По итогу — я очень доволен этим сервисом.

Скачать



Great! Next, complete checkout for full access to All-In-One Person
Welcome back! You've successfully signed in
You've successfully subscribed to All-In-One Person
Success! Your account is fully activated, you now have access to all content
Success! Your billing info has been updated
Your billing was not updated